Abstract
Synthetic biology defies traditional views about the scope of biological inquiry (Hull 1978; Waters 2007; Weber 2013;). Some authors are skeptical about the epistemic value the field has to the rest of the life sciences (Keller 2009a). This paper demonstrates how artificial biochemistries of life serve an essential epistemic function as semifactual models in biology (Knuuttila and Koskinen 2021). As semifactual models, alternative biochemistries of life facilitate the testing of hypotheses about universal biological constraints. Importantly, clarifying this role also unveils further research questions that would lend greater rigor to synthetic biology research programs.
